title image


Smiley Re: Anmelde-Formular durch PHP realisieren?
Ok, mal eben Versuchen:



<?php

if(isset($_POST['name'])){

$name = $_POST['name'];

$vorname = $_POST['vorname'];

$uni = $_POST['uni'];

$vortrag = $_POST['vortrag'];

$thema = $_POST['thema'];

$schlaf = $_POST['schlaf'];



$empfaenger = "Empfaenger@adresse.de";



$body="<b>Name:</b> " . $name . "<br />\n";

$body=$body . "<b>Vorname:</b> " . $vorname . "<br />\n";

$body=$body . "<b>Universität:</b> " . $uni . "<br />\n";

$body=$body . "<b>Vortrag:</b> " . $vortrag . "<br />\n";

$body=$body . "<b>Thema des Vortrages:</b> ".$thema . "<br />\n";

$body=$body . "<b>Schlafplatz benötigt:</b>".$schlaf."<br />\n";

$subject="Anmeldung".$subject;



$headers=$headers . "MIME-Version: 1.0 \r\n";

$headers=$headers . "Content-type: text/html; charset=iso-8859-1 \r\n";

$headers=$headers . 'From: ' . $email . " \r\n";

$headers=$headers . 'Reply-To: ' . $email . " \r\n";

$headers=$headers . 'Return-Path: ' . $email . " \r\n";

$headers=$headers . 'Date: ' . date("r") . " \r\n";

$headers=$headers . "X-Priority: 6 \r\n";

$headers=$headers . "X-Mailer: Uni-Blubb \r\n";



mail( $empfaenger,$subject, $body, $headers );

}

else{

?>

<form action="test2.php" method="post">

<table border=0>

<tr><td>Name:</td><td><INPUT type="text" size="22" value="" name="name"></td></tr>

<tr><td>Vorname:</td><td><INPUT type="text" size="22" value="" name="vorname"></td></tr>

<tr><td>Universität:</td><td><INPUT type="text" size="22" value="" name="uni"></td></tr>

<tr><td>Vortrag:</td><td><input type="radio" name="vortrag" value="Ja"> Ja <input type="radio" name="vortrag" value="Nein"> Nein</td></tr>

<tr><td>Thema des Vortrages:</td><td><INPUT type="text" size="22" value="" name="thema"></td></tr>

<tr><td>Schlafplatz benötigt:</td><td><input type="radio" name="schlaf" value="Ja"> Ja <input type="radio" name="schlaf" value="Nein"> Nein</td></tr>

</table>

<INPUT type="submit" value="Senden">

</form>



<?php

}

?>



So sollte es eigentlich gehen. Aber da ist jetzt keine Überprüfung drin, welche Felder alle gesetzt wurde. Es wir nur geguckt ob "gesendet" wurde.
MfG
MasterFX


Asus A8N-E
Athlon 64 X2 3800+@ 2,4GHz
3GB PC400
Leadtek PX6600GT Extreme Version
250GB Hitachi 7200 U/Min 8MB Cache
NEC 5700B DVD-ROM
NEC 3500A 16x DVD-Brenner

Mein Blog:
MasterFX's Funblog

geschrieben von

Login

E-Mail:
  

Passwort:
  

Beitrag anfügen

Symbol:
 
 
 
 
 
 
 
 
 
 
 
 
 

Überschrift: